        • PRELIMINARY EVALUATION ON SEROMA PREVENTION AND TREATMENT WITH TRANSPOSITION OF TISSUE FLAPS AND ARISTA HEMOSTATIC POWDER

          Objective To investigate and evaluate prevention and treatment of seroma by transposition of tissue flaps and Arista hemostatic powder after regional lymph node resection in patients with malignant tumors. Methods Twelve patients (6 males, 6 females; aged 31-81 years, with metastatic tumors underwent prevention and treatment of seroma with the tissue flaps and Arista hemostatic powder spray after regional lymph node resection. The metastatic tumors involved the axilla in 1 patient with breast carcinoma, the iliac and inguinal regions in 2 patients with carcinomas of theuterine cervix and the rectum, and the inguinal region in 9 patients, including4 patients with malignant fibrous histiocytoma(3 in the thigh, 1 in the leg),2 patients with squamous carcinomas in the leg, 1 patient with synovial sarcomain the knee, 1 patient with epithelioid sarcoma in the leg, and 1 patient with malignant melanoma in the foot. As for the lymph node removal therapy. 1 patientunderwent axillary lymph node removal, 2 palients underwent lymph node removal in theiliac and inguinal regions, and 9 patients underwent lymph node removal inthe inguinal region. Meanwhile, of the 12 patients, 6 patients underwent transpostion of sartourius flaps with Arista hemostatic powder, 3 patients underwent transposition of the rectus abdominis myocutaneous flaps (including 2 patients treatedwith Arista spray befor the wound closure and 1 patient treated by transposition of local skin flaps with Arista spray used again),and 3 patients underwent only the suturing of the wounds combined with Arista. At the same time, of the 12 patients,only 4 patient underwent the transplantation of artificial blood vessels. Results The follow-up for 2-10 months after operation revealed that 10 patients, who had received the transposition of tissue flaps and the spray of Arista hemostatic powder, had the first intention of the incision heal with seroma cured. Nine patients were given a preventive use of Arista hemostaticpowder and therefore no seroma developed. The combined use of the transpositionof tissue flaps and Arista hemostatic powder spray achieved a success rate of 100% in the prevention or treatment of seroma. However, 1 patient developed microcirculation disturbance 24 hours after operation and underwent disarticulation of the hip; 1 patient developed pelvic cavity hydrops and died 10 months after operation. Conclusion The combined use of transposition of tissue flaps and Arista hemostatic powder spray can effectively prevent or treat seroma after regional lymph node removal in a patient with malignant tumor.

        • The relationship between Beclin 1 expression and lymph node metastasis in non-small cell lung cancer

          ObjectiveTo explore the relationship between Beclin 1 level and lymph node metastasis in patients with non-small cell lung cancer.MethodA total of 204 surgical specimens of patients with non-small cell lung cancer from September 2011 to September 2016 were collected in our hospital. There were 116 males and 88 females . Beclin 1 levels were detected by Western blotting. There were 116 males and 88 females at average age of 55.3±11.2 years. The patients were divided into three groups including a group N0 (no lymph node metastasis), a group N1(intralobar and interlobar lymph node metastases, and no mediastinal lymph node metastasis), and a group N2 (mediastinal lymph node metastasis). The differences of Beclin 1 levels in tumor tissues and lymph nodes of patients with N0, N1 and N2 were statistically analyzed.ResultsAmong 204 patients of lung cancer, 36 patients were squamous cell carcinoma and 168 patients were adenocarcinoma. The levels of Beclin 1 in tumor tissues of N0, N1 and N2 groups decreased gradually with a statistical difference (P<0.05). In the three groups, the levels of Beclin 1 in the lung hilum and intrapulmonary lymph nodes (N1 Beclin 1) of N1 and N2 groups were less than that of N0 group with a statistical difference (P<0.01). In the three groups, the level of Beclin 1 in the mediastinal lymph nodes (N2 Beclin 1) of N2 group was less than that of the N0 and N1 groups with a statistical difference (P<0.01). In the N1 group, the level of N1 Beclin 1 was less than that of N2 group (P<0.01). In the N2 group, though the level of N1 Beclin 1 was less than N2 Beclin 1, there was no statistical difference (P>0.05). ConclusionBeclin 1 level can be used as a reference index to judge the benign and malignant lung masses, and lymph node Beclin 1 level can be used as an important reference index to help determine whether there is lymph node metastasis in lung cancer.

        • The predictive value of preoperative serum CA19-9 for lymph node micrometastasis in patients with gastric cancer and its effect on prognosis

          Objective This study aimed to investigate the predictive value of preoperative serum CA19-9 level for lymph node micrometastasis in patients with lymph node metastasis-negative gastric cancer and its effect on prognosis. Methods Clinicopathological data were retrospectively collected from 176 cases of gastric cancer who underwent D2 radical surgery in our hospital between January 2006 and December 2011, and also collected the patients’ lymph node tissue specimens. All patients were confirmed by pathologic examination of lymph node metastasis-negative. Quantitative real-time PCR (qRT-PCR) was used to detect the presence of lymph node micrometastasis in lymph node tissues. Sixty cases of gastric cancer were selected to construct the receiver operating characteristic curve (ROC) of preoperative serum CA19-9 level to predict lymph node micrometastasis, then established the threshold value. The remaining 116 cases were used to validate the rationality of this threshold. In addition, we explored the impact of preoperative serum CA19-9 level on the prognosis of patients with lymph node metastasis-negative gastric cancer, and explored the risk factors of lymph node micrometastasis. Results ① Results of ROC curve: the preoperative serum CA19-9 level of 15.5 U/mL was the threshold for predicting lymph node micrometastasis, with a sensitivity of 93.1%, specificity of 63.6%, and area under the curve (AUC) of 0.84 (P=0.003). With 15.5 U/mL as the threshold, 116 patients were divided into positive group and negative group. The lymph node micrometastasis rates in the 2 groups were different, which was higher in the positive group than that in the negative group (P<0.001). ② Effect of preoperative serum CA19-9 level on prognosis: the patients were divided into the positive group and the negative group with 15.5 U/mL as the threshold, and the log-rank test showed that the survival of the negative group was better than that of the positive group (P=0.001). ③ The risk factors for lymph node micrometastasis: the logistic regression model showed that preoperatively positive serum CA19-9 was an independent risk factor for lymph node micrometastasis in patients with gastric cancer [OR=1.860, 95% CI was (1.720, 2.343), P<0.001]. Conclusion Preoperative serum CA19-9 level can be used to predict lymph node micrometastasis in lymph node metastasis-negative patients with gastric cancer.

        • Retrospective study of lymph node metastasis and pathological characteristics of gastric cancer

          Objective To explore regularity of lymph node metastasis and analyze its relation between lymph node metastasis and histological features and its immunohistochemical markers of gastric cancer, and to provide evidence for selection of reasonable operation. Method The clinical data of 160 patients with gastric cancer who underwent D2, D3 or D3+ from August 2013 to May 2016 in the Second Hospital of Lanzhou University were retrospectively studied, and the relation between the lymph node metastasis and the pathological features and the immunohistochemical markers in the different location of gastric cancer was analyzed. Results ① The rate of lymph node metastasis in the early gastric cancer was significantly lower than that in the advanced gastric cancer (P<0.05), which in the T4 stage was significantly higher than that in the T1–T3 stages (P<0.05), in the poorly differentiated gastric cancer was significantly higher than that in the well differentiated gastric cancer (P<0.05), or in the Borrmann type Ⅲ+Ⅳ (infiltrative type) was significantly higher than that in the Borrmann type Ⅰ+Ⅱ (topical type,P<0.05), but which wasn’t associated with the gender, tumor location, or tumor diameter (P>0.05). ② The lymph node metastasis occurred mainly in the first and the second stations for the well differentiated gastric cardia cancer, which not only occurred in the first and the second stations, but also occurred in the No.13 lymph node for the poorly differentiated gastric cardia cancer; which occurred mainly in the first and the second stations and occasionally occurred in the No.12 lymph node for the well differentiated gastric body cancer, which not only occurred in the first and the second stations, but also occurred in the No.12, No.13 and No.14 lymph nodes for the poorly differentiated gastric body cancer; which occurred in the No.11, No.12 and No.13 lymph nodes for the part of well differentiated gastric antrum cancer, which even occurred in the No.15 and No.16 lymph nodes for the part of poorly differentiated gastric antrum cancer. ③ The expression positive rates of the TopoⅡα, Villin, Ki-67, CK-8, and CK-18 proteins in the poorly differentiated gastric cancer were significantly higher than those in the well differentiated gastric cancer (P<0.05), which of the P-gp, GST-π, and c-erbB-2 proteins in the poorly differentiated gastric cancer were significantly lower than those in the well differentiated gastric cancer (P<0.05). The expression positive rates of the TopoⅡα, P-gp, Villin, Ki-67, CK-8, and CK-18 proteins in the gastric cancer with lymph node metastasis were significantly higher than those in the gastric cancer without lymph node metastasis (P<0.05), whereas there were no relation between the expression positive rates of the GST-π and c-erbB-2 proteins and the lymph node metastasis of gastric cancer (P>0.05). ④ The different location of gastric cancer wasn’t associated with the gender, gross type, clinical stage, T stage, degree of differentiation, Borrmann type, or tumor diameter. Conclusions In advanced gastric cancer, depth of tumor invasion reached T4, poor degree of differentiation, and Borrmann infiltration type of gastric cancer, lymph node metastasis rates are higher. For gastric cardia cancer patients with well differentiation, standard D2 should be performed, D2+No.13 should be performed for poor differentiation. For gastric body cancer patients with well differentiation, D2+No.12 should be performed, D3 should be performed for poor differentiation. For gastric antrum cancer patients with differentiation degree or not, D3 should be performed, selective dissection of No.15 or No.16 lymph node should be performed for poor differentiation. Combined detection of TopoⅡα, Villin, Ki-67, CK-8, CK-18, P-gp, GST-π, and c-erbB-2 immunohistochemical markers might be helpful to improve accuracy of lymph node metastasis and evaluate degree of malignancy and prognosis of patients with gastric cancer.

        • Risk Factors of Hepatoduodenal Lymph Node Metastasis in Advanced Gastric Cancer and The Impact on Prognosis

          ObjectiveTo investigate the risk factors of hepatoduodenal lymph node (HDLN) metastasis in patients with advanced gastric cancer and its effect on prognosis. MethodsClinical datas of patients with advanced gastric cancer who underwent D2 radical gastrectomy for gastric cancer and HDLN dissection between Jan 2011 and Nov 2013 in department of general surgery of Ankang Central Hospital were retrospectively reviewed. Multivariate logistic regression analysis was performed to identify the independent risk factors associated with HDLN metastasis. Survival curves were performed to compare the survival rate of patients with or without HDLN metastasis and of patients with HDLN metastasis or with other lymph node metastasis. A Cox proportional hazards model was used for the multivariate analysis of risk factors for death in advanced gastric cancer. ResultsThe incidence of HDLN metastasis was 10.7% in patients with advanced gastric cancer. Multivariate logistic regression analyses revealed that the middle or lower stomach cancer (OR=6.014, P=0.002) and stage T3 or T4 (OR=5.133, P=0.021) were independent risk factors for HDLN metastasis. The 2-year overall survival (OS) rate was 36.7% in patients with HDLN metastasis. It was lower in patients with HDLN metastasis compared with those without (P=0.002). Limited to node-positive patients, patients with HDLN metastasis demonstrated decreased 2-year OS rate compared with node-positive patients without HDLN metastasis (P=0.027). Cox proportional hazard analysis identified poorly differentiated or undifferentiated cancer, stage of T3 or T4, and HDLN metastasis were independent poor prognostic factors in the patients with advanced gastric cancer (P < 0.05). ConclusionsCancer located in the middle or lower stomach, and stage T3 or T4 were independent risk factors for HDLN metastasis in patients with advanced gastric cancer. HDLN metastasis demonstrated a poor prognosis.

        • Preliminary Study of Bacterial Culture in Mesenteric Lymph Nodes of Patients with Small Bowel Obstruction

          Objective To explore the bacterial translocation of mesenteric lymph nodes (MLNs) of the ileum and the spectrum of bacteria in patients with small bowel obstruction.Methods Total 84 patients were divided into study group (with small bowel obstruction) and control group (without small bowel obstruction). MLNs were obtained under sterile conditions intraoperatively, and which were processed for culture of aerobic and anaerobic organisms. The rate of bacterial translocation and postoperative infection were compared between two groups and the species of bacterial translocation was identified. Results The bacterial translocation rate in the study group was higher than that in the control group 〔57.1% (24/42) versus 16.7% (7/42),χ2=14.775, P<0.01〕. Escherichia coil was the most commonly bacteria (20). Emergency surgery and age over 70 years were associated with bacterial translocation (P<0.05). Postoperative infection complications rate in the bacterial translocation patients was higher than that in the patients without bacterial translocation 〔29.0% (9/31) versus 3.8% (2/53),χ2=10.965,P<0.05〕. Conclusions Bacterial translocation to MLNs occurres more frequently in patients with small bowel obstruction,non-elective surgery, and elderly.

        • The preoperative predictive value of a nomogram for predicting cervical lymph node metastasis in papillary thyroid microcarcinoma patients based on SEER database

          Objective To explore the potential indicators of cervical lymph node metastasis in papillary thyroid microcarcinoma (PTMC) patients and to develop a nomogram model. Methods The clinicopathologic features of PTMC patients in the SEER database from 2004 to 2015 and PTMC patients who were admitted to the Center for Thyroid and Breast Surgery of Xuanwu Hospital from 2019 to 2020 were retrospectively analyzed. The records of SEER database were divided into training set and internal verification set according to 7∶3. The patients data of Xuanwu Hospital were used as the external verification set. Logistic regression and Lasso regression were used to analyze the potential indicators for cervical lymph node metastasis. A nomogram was developed and whose predictive value was verified in the internal and external validation sets. According to the preoperative ultrasound imaging characteristics, the risk scores for PTMC patients were further calculated. The consistency between the scores based on pathologic and ultrasound imaging characteristics was verified. Results The logistic regression analysis results illustrated that male, age<55 years old, tumor size, multifocality, and extrathyroidal extension were associated with cervical lymph node metastasis in PTMC patients (P<0.001). The C index of the nomogram was 0.722, and the calibration curve exhibited to be a fairly good consistency with the perfect prediction in any set. The ROC curve of risk score based on ultrasound characteristics for predicting lymph node metastasis in PTMC patients was 0.701 [95%CI was (0.637 4, 0.765 6)], which was consistent with the risk score based on pathological characteristics (Kappa value was 0.607, P<0.001). Conclusions The nomogram model for predicting the lymph node metastasis of PTMC patients shows a good predictive value, and the risk score based on the preoperative ultrasound imaging characteristics has good consistency with the risk score based on pathological characteristics.

        • Effect of postoperative radiotherapy after neoadjuvant chemotherapy and modified radical surgery on specific survival of patients with stage cT1–2N1M0 breast cancer: propensity score matching analysis based on SEER database

          Objective To investigate the effect of radiotherapy after neoadjuvant chemotherapy and modified radical surgery on breast cancer specific survival (BCSS) of patients with stage cT1–2N1M0 breast cancer. Methods A total of 917 cT1–2N1M0 stage breast cancer patients treated with neoadjuvant chemotherapy and modified radical surgery from 2010 to 2017 were extracted from the The Surveillance, Epidemiology, and End Results (SEER) database. Of them 720 matched patients were divided into radiotherapy group (n=360) and non-radiotherapy group (n=360) by using propensity score matching (PSM). Cox proportional hazard regression model was used to explore the factors affecting BCSS. Results Patients were all interviewed for a median follow-up of 65 months, and the 5-year BCSS was 91.9% in the radiotherapy group and 93.2% in the non-radiotherapy group, there was no significant difference between the 2 groups (χ2=0.292, P=0.589). The results were the same in patients with no axillary lymph node metastasis, one axillary lymphnode metastasis, two axillary lymph node metastasis and 3 axillary lymph node metastasis group (χ2=0.139, P=0.709; χ2=0.578, P=0.447; χ2=2.617, P=0.106; χ2=0.062, P=0.803). The result of Cox proportional hazard regression analysis showed that, after controlling for Grade grade, time from diagnosis to treatment, efficacy of neoadjuvant chemotherapy, number of positive axillary lymph nodes, molecular typing, and tumor diameter at first diagnosis, radiotherapy had no statistically significant effect on BCSS [HR=1.048, 95%CI (0.704, 1.561), P=0.817]. Conclusions The effect of radiotherapy on the BCSS of patients with stage cT1–2N1M0 breast cancer who have received neoadjuvant chemotherapy and modified radical surgery with 0 to 3 axillary lymph nodes metastases is limited, but whether to undergo radiotherapy should still be determined according to the comprehensive risk of individual tumor patients.

        • Risk factors of lymph node metastasis in T1 rectal cancer

          Objective To explore risk factors of lymph node metastasis (LNM) in T1 rectal cancer. Methods The retrospective case-control study was conducted. The clinicopathologic data of 247 patients with T1 rectal cancer underwent radical resection were analyzed in the pathological database of the West China Hospital from January 2000 to December 2016, including the tumor size (maximum diameter), gross type, differentiation degree, histological type, lymph vascular infiltration, perineural infiltration, and carcinoma nodule. The univariate analysis and multivariate analysis were done using the Chi-square test and logistic regression model, respectively. Results The rate of LNM in the patients with T1 rectal cancer was 8.50% (21/247). No lymph metastasis was found in the well differentiated T1 rectal cancer. The results of the univariate analysis showed that the differentiation degree, histological type, and carcinoma nodule were related to the LNM in the T1 rectal cancer (P<0.050). The results of the multivariate analysis revealed that the poor differentiation, mucinous adenocarcinoma, signet-ring cell carcinoma, and carcinoma nodule were the independent risk factors of the LNM in the T1 rectal cancer (OR=9.75, P=0.006; OR=5.98, P=0.042; OR=8.33, P=0.017; OR=10.87, P=0.026). Conclusion In this large population dataset, poor differentiation, mucinous adenocarcinoma, signet-ring cell carcinoma, and carcinoma nodule are risk factors of LNM in T1 rectal cancer.

        • The association between cancer location and lymph node metastasis in early stage of breast cancer

          Objective To summarize the relation between tumor location and lymph node metastasis in early stage of breast cancer, which is aimed at providing a more individualized treatment for breast cancer patients. Method The literatures about breast cancer location and lymph node metastasis in recent years were extracted, through the literatures study we made a thematic review of the relation between them. Results There were two main classification methods for the location of breast tumors at present: tumor in the different quadrants and tumor to skin distance. In the quadrant classification method, the tumor in the upper inner quadrant (UIQ) had the lowest lymph node metastasis rate, while the lower inner quadrant (LIQ) tumor recurrence-free survival rate and overall survival rate were significantly lower than other quadrants. When measuring tumor to skin distance, the closer the tumor was to the skin, the more likely lymph node metastasis occurred. In combination with the distribution, histology, and anatomical differences of lymphatic and lymphatic networks, our study group proposed to classify tumors according to different anatomical levels of the breast, thus the anatomic location of the tumor was divided into four types: constricted in the gland, break the anterior gland, break the posterior gland, and break both anterior and posterior gland. Conclusions Regardless of the way the location is classified, the location of breast tumors is closely related to lymphatic and lymph node metastasis. The new classification according to the distribution of tumors at different anatomical levels of the breast accords with the law of lymphatic metastasis is scientific and reasonable. Therefore, during clinical practices, we recommend to use the new method to classify tumor location, and we should consider the differences in the location of the patients’ tumor to assess the status of axillary lymph node, which may provide a more individualized treatment for breast cancer patients.
